Output 26a8b123c0caa1f42b05d0f64f3e8273fede37a6af53d4ae4f739381a176aeb5:0

value
27810194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df918e1f0ad866f485abf62dfdd682fbd4234216 OP_EQUAL
address
3N58yfvJbg2zAzbfxvHFmuydB75roydFcC
transaction
26a8b123c0caa1f42b05d0f64f3e8273fede37a6af53d4ae4f739381a176aeb5
confirmations
360110
spent
true